Bournemouth have signed Ghana forward Antoine Semenyo from Bristol City for more than £10m on a four-and-a-half-year deal.

The 23-year-old scored 21 goals and provided 22 assists during his time at the Robins, where he came through the academy. He previously had loan spells at Bath City, Newport County and Sunderland.

Arsenal verbally agree Rice deal

It emerged earlier this month that Arsenal had made Declan Rice their top summer transfer target and there is some big news in their pursuit of the West Ham midfielder this morning.

Rice has “verbally agreed” a move to Emirates Stadium. That is according to Catalan newspaper El Nacional, who say Real Madrid have missed out on Rice because is set to join Arsenal.

Gusto set for Chelsea medical

Chelsea are set to complete the signing of Lyon full-back Malo Gusto. The two clubs have agreed a fee of around £26m but the 19-year-old will remain with the Ligue 1 side on loan for the rest of the season.

Gusto had been identified as the Blues’ leading choice to provide cover and competition for Reece James, who has seen his season decimated by injury so far.
